## Catalogue import — Wrenmoor Library Service

Nightly import pulls MARC records from the Hollowfen consortium feed at 02:10. If the job stalls, check the importer pod logs first; the usual failure is a rejected handshake with the feed gateway. Do not rerun mid-window — duplicate bib records are painful to purge. Restart order: stop importer, clear the staging table, restart with the fresh env file. The importer authenticates to the Hollowfen gateway using the credential set on the next line of that file.

sealed setting: ARCHIVE_KEY3=8d0

## Authentication

For the eng sync: the Ledgerloom payroll export moved from fixed-width to JSON Lines in v9, and the export endpoint now enforces signed requests. Old exporters will receive 426 responses after the cutover. Regenerate your test fixtures against staging before Friday. To call the staging export service, use the key below.

service key, fawip-bajef: kto11_Qt5wZK9vdNC

Subject: Key rotation — Scanline barcode integration

Hi! Quick heads up before Thursday's cut: we rotated the service key the Scanline bridge uses to talk to the Cartwheel inventory API. Old key dies Friday noon, so make sure the release config picks up the new one — otherwise every scanner in the Brindlemoor warehouse goes dark. New key is below.

gateway credential: kto15_BFZGGy3oznOSd45